How to Get Replacement Car Keys: A Comprehensive Guide
Losing a car key can be a frustrating and demanding experience. Car keys are important for accessing and beginning your vehicle. Luckily, there are several ways to get a replacement set of car keys. This post checks out the various approaches car owners can utilize to replace their lost keys, including expenses, ideas for avoidance, and commonly asked questions.
Types of Car Keys
Before talking about replacement options, it's important to know the different types of car keys offered today. Understanding the type of key you have can streamline the replacement process.

There are a number of methods to replace lost or damaged car keys, each with its special procedure and associated costs.
1. Calling Your Dealership
If the lost key is a clever key or transponder key, contacting your dealer is typically the most dependable technique. They have the required devices and proficiency to produce a brand-new key particular to your vehicle design.

Process:
Gather your vehicle information (make, design, year, VIN).Visit or call the dealership for instructions.They will need evidence of ownership, such as the car title or registration.Some key fob replacements may need to be configured on-site.
Approximated Costs:

Locksmiths can frequently supply a quicker and more affordable option to dealerships, especially for traditional keys or simple transponder keys.

Process:
Find a regional locksmith with competence in automotive keys.Show proof of ownership.The locksmith can cut a brand-new key and might have the ability to program a transponder key too.
Approximated Costs:

A1: Yes, most dealers and locksmiths can develop a replacement key utilizing your vehicle identification number (VIN) and proof of ownership.
Q2: How long does it require to get a replacement key?
A2: The time can differ based upon the method you select. Car dealerships might take longer due to setting needs, while locksmiths and online services might provide quicker options.
Q3: Is it safe to utilize online services for replacement keys?
A3: While numerous online retailers use authentic key replacements, it's crucial to research the seller to guarantee they are reputable.
Q4: What if my key is broken rather than lost?
A4: A locksmith professional or car dealership can typically help you produce a brand-new key based on the broken one, so bring it along if possible.
